Independent developer Rebellion today announced the launch of two new pieces of DLC for Sniper Elite 3 on Steam for PC, with the content due to come to Playstation 4, Xbox One, Xbox 360 and Playstation 3 later this month.

FREE Outpost Canyon Multiplayer Map

The fourth FREE multiplayer map for Sniper Elite 3 on all platforms, Outpost Canyon sees sharpshooters battle across an abandoned supply line, high up in the windswept Atlas Mountains.

Ominously deserted, the map is littered with evidence of previous skirmishes for what was once a crucial supply line for German forces; forgotten artillery positions and the scorched remains of vehicles mark the undulating landscape, ridges and barren river-bed.

With a free-flowing design and multiple elevated positions Outpost Canyon is an expansive addition to the Sniper Elite 3 multiplayer suite.

Axis Weapons Pack

Sniper Elite 3 players can now turn their enemies’ best weapons against them with new firearms from the German, Royal Italian and Imperial Japanese armies including the Type 99 – king of the long distance rifles.

All three weapons can be used in any multiplayer, singleplayer or co-operative game mode in Sniper Elite 3. The Axis Weapons Pack is available for just $3.99.

The Axis Weapons Pack includes:

  • Type 99 rifle: Japanese made with a higher zoom and lower recoil, this bolt action rifle is one of strongest long range weapons available.
  • MAB 38 submachine gun: boasting an improved rate of fire, range and zoom this Italian submachine gun has a distinct advantage over most.
  • Army Pistol 38: used by German officers and soldiers alike this semi-automatic pistol has a strong rate of fire whilst still maintaining its impressive range.

historical-article-uss-enterprise-the-big-e-logoThe US Navy’s most combat decorated ship of WWII

By John Dudek @ The Wargamer

Enterprise and her aircraft carrier kith and kin were still considered something of a revolutionary anomaly when she first entered the waters of the Newport News Shipyard and Dry Dock Company on an October Saturday in 1936. Theodore Mason in his book “Battleship Sailor” later observed. “If some seer had told me then that the Enterprise would steam to glory on one of the most brilliant combat records of any ship in the history of the US Navy, I would have given him the pitying smile one normally reserves for fools.” She was christened Enterprise, the seventh ship so named to serve the United States Navy. The aircraft carrier was then one of two ships in the Yorktown Class of warships. She was 824 feet in length and 114 feet wide. She was powered by 9 x Babcock & Wilcox boilers with 4 x Parsons geared turbines that generated 120,000 ship horsepower to her four huge bronze propellers, giving her a top speed of 32.5 knots. Enterprise had a range of 12,500 nautical miles at a moderate cruising speed of 15 knots. The crew compliment she took into battle in 1941 was some 2,217 officers and men. Her defensive armament consisted of 8 x single 5in/38 caliber guns, 4.x quad 1.1″ flak guns and 24 x .50 caliber water cooled machine guns. This armament would be changed and greatly augmented many times over in the coming months, especially after the ship’s first taste of battle against enemy aircraft. Enterprise’s primary offensive and defensive punch lay in the 90 fighter planes, torpedo planes and dive bombers carried in her hangar deck below. To warn of incoming enemy aircraft, the aircraft carrier carried a CXAM-1 RADAR atop her main mast that enabled them to see the approach of planes at a range of 70 miles or more.

pike-and-shot-box“War is not a river, or a lake, but an ocean of all that is evil” (Gustav II Adolf, King of Sweden)

Initially introduced to the lucky few who attended our 2014 annual convention “Home of Wargamers”, Pike & Shot is now mature enough to show more of the game to public! This upcoming strategy game designed by Richard Bodley Scott – the mastermind behind the Field of Glory table-top wargame rules – aims to simulate the majors battles in the age of Pike and Shot – the 16th and 17th centuries.

The period covered by this game is particularly interesting from a tactical point of view as lots of changes occurred on the battlefield at that time. In only two hundred years commanders have been substituting traditional medieval tactics with modern ones, inserting musketeers and artillery in the armies. Obviously the players will be able to feel this tactical revolution in Pike & Shot!

This setting, combined with the approachable and visually immersive Battle Academy engine, makes Pike & Shot a very engaging title for any gamer that has an interest for this period. 3 huge campaigns, a skirmish mode that allows to generate an infinite number of “What-if” scenarios and a multiplayer system powered by the famous PBEM++ come together for a captivating experience in the heart of the bloodiest battles of the Renaissance.

Pike & Shot is currently in beta and will release later this year for PC, with an iPad version following soon.

supreme-ruler-ultimate-boxBattleGoat Studios is proud today to announce Supreme Ruler Ultimate, the most ambitious and comprehensive title in our Supreme Ruler strategy game series. With the announcement of Supreme Ruler Ultimate David Thompson, Lead Designer and Co-Founder explained, “Our recent release of Supreme Ruler 1936 has proven to be very popular with our fans and strategy/wargame players as it revolves around World War II, but one of the biggest requests we’ve received has been to blend it with the near future game we released back in 2008, Supreme Ruler 2020. That game provided players with the opportunity to make anything they wanted of our modern world, from any starting nation, without any preconceived expectations.”

Supreme Ruler Ultimate will incorporate the content from all of BattleGoat’s Supreme Ruler series, letting players take control of a nation from the historic troubles of World War II, through the Cold War, and into the near future where established relations are undermined by disorder and turmoil. Thompson went on to comment, “With what is currently going on internationally and the intense domestic polarization forming within various countries, it certainly is not hard to imagine a spark spreading unparalleled chaos through our world.” Thompson indicated that BattleGoat will continue to add historic events and content to the game for players that want to start in the 20th century, as well as updating the near future storyline to incorporate new technology threads and to reflect the new international crises that have developed.

Supreme Ruler Ultimate will be released on October 17, 2014 at an SRP of $29.99, and an announcement regarding a Steam Early Access Beta is expected soon. BattleGoat have also announced that owners of Supreme Ruler 1936 will be given a special upgrade price to the new title.
